Why I studied DEC

I chose to pursue A Levels to keep my university options open, while knowing that my long-term interest has always been rooted in the built environment, whether in building design or project management.

To deepen this interest, I decided to pursue the DEC qualification alongside my A Levels, allowing me to gain a more practical and comprehensive understanding of building processes and project lifecycles. Through this, I was able to explore the responsibilities of different roles at each stage of development.

Now in university, I find that this early exposure has given me a strong foundation, as I am more confident with technical skills and familiar with industry terminology compared to many of my peers.”

My aims for the future

I want to be a licensed architect in Victoria, Australia and be involved in social architecture organisations, such as ‘Australian Architects Declare’ and  ‘Architecture without Frontiers’.

I’d like to continue to shape positive change for our community through more sustainable and equitable living spaces.
